i don't think you need a camera that takes AA batteries. My camera will stay charged for almost 600 photos. I can fully charge it and use it for a LONG time before it needs recharged. Not once have I ever ran out of juice using the camera. As long as the battery your camera has is lithium ion, you'll be fine. And you're not likely to find the better quality cameras running off of AA or AAA batteries anyways.
The only time I have my camera charger with me is when I'm going out of town and staying somewhere. And even then I've never had to use the charger. The newest batteries in these cameras have amazingly long run times. And there are many things you can do to help them last longer. For example, making it so the pictures don't show on the LCD screen too long.. change the setting down to 1-2 seconds. Turn off the beep. Turn off the auto-focus assist light when using in lit conditions. Also don't sit and zoom in and out a lot if you don't need to. that uses power. I would like to point out that on a lot of Sony and Canon smaller cameras, you get a lot of purple shading on the edge of brighter objects. Some cameras do this really bad. I've never noticed it much at all with my fuji. And one more note on batteries. Trust me, cameras use AA or AAA batteries up fast. To even have decent runtime you'll need to buy lithium-ion batteries. last I checked you're at least $12 for a 4 pack. I think that might have been on sale too. I've used someone's camera that used AA batteries and they did not last near as long as a normal camera battery that's lithium-ion. Btw, right now fuji cameras have one of the best batteries on the market for these smaller cameras. |

Here ya go, onlyh $54 higher than you suggested. I've bought several items, including a digital slr, from this company, and have had no problems. You do get a U.S. warranty, and service is quick.
A camera, even a point-n-shoot, with no provision for external flash is worthless to me. Built-in flash is wimpy. This camera is 9 megapixels; has a huge zoom. (You ought to disable digital zoom on any camera you buy, as it's worthless.) http://www.buydig.com/shop/product.aspx?sku=FJFPS9000 Go to Wal-Mart and get the Digital name brand one-hour battery charger for just under $19. Comes with four 2500 mah batteries and works all over the world with no adapter. You can get four extra batteries for under $7. Last edited by Mercmar; 05-01-2007 at 05:50 PM. |
